Wenn Sa.So.+Feiertag,dann...
#1
hallo Zusammen,
ich suche eine Lösung,das an den Tagen die ein Sa.So.+Feiertage beinhalten,
die Nachbarzellen nicht mit den Namen der Mitarbeiter ausgefüllt werden.
Da diese manuell eingetragen werden.

Danke
Antworten Top
#2
Hi,

trage deine Namen in der Datenüberprüfung nicht manuell ein, sondern gib den betreffenden Bereich als Liste ein. Zusätzlich zu den Namen nimmst du noch eine Leerzelle auf. Dann klicke auf das Menü "Fehlermeldung" und nimm dort das Häkchen bei "Fehlermeldung anzeigen,..." raus.

Nun kannst du im Zellendropdown die Leerzelle anklicken und manuell andere Werte eingeben.
Gruß Günter
Jeder Fehler erscheint unglaublich dumm, wenn andere ihn begehen.
angebl. von Georg Christoph Lichtenberg (1742-1799)
Antworten Top
#3
moin,
danke erstmal.Mit manuel meinte ich,das dir händisch nach Ausdruck eingetragen werden.
Da sich an diesen Tagen jederzeit die Namen änden können.
Deine Dropdownvariante funktioniert.Nur habe ich immer noch keinen Lösung,
das die Sa.So+Feiertagezellen frei bleiben.Klar,könnte die auch makieren+dann löschen.
Dies wäre aber 1.Arbeitschritt mehr.Und das muss nicht sein.

Danke
Antworten Top
#4
Hi,

sorry, aber deinen Einwand verstehe ich jetzt nicht. Du füllst deine MA-Zellen doch über Zellendropdown aus - dann überspringe halt die Wochenenden.
Gruß Günter
Jeder Fehler erscheint unglaublich dumm, wenn andere ihn begehen.
angebl. von Georg Christoph Lichtenberg (1742-1799)
Antworten Top
#5
Moin!
Du färbst in Spalte A doch bereits die WE und Feiertage korrekt per Formel ein!
Setze für Spalte B eine weitere bedingte Formatierung, wenn es Dir "nur" um die Darstellung geht.
Formel ist: =ZÄHLENWENN($D$7:$D$20;$A7)+WENNFEHLER(WOCHENTAG($A7;2)>5;0)+($A7="")
ben.def. Zahlenformat ist ;;;

AB
6Datum
7Sa. 01.06.19
8So. 02.06.19
9Mo. 03.06.19Mustermann1
10Di. 04.06.19Mustermann1
11Mi. 05.06.19Mustermann1
12Do. 06.06.19Mustermann1
13Fr. 07.06.19Mustermann1
14Sa. 08.06.19
15So. 09.06.19
16Mo. 10.06.19
17Di. 11.06.19Mustermann1
18Mi. 12.06.19Mustermann1
19Do. 13.06.19Mustermann1
20Fr. 14.06.19Mustermann1
21Sa. 15.06.19
22So. 16.06.19
23Mo. 17.06.19Mustermann1
24Di. 18.06.19Mustermann1
25Mi. 19.06.19Mustermann1
26Do. 20.06.19
27Fr. 21.06.19Mustermann1
28Sa. 22.06.19
29So. 23.06.19
30Mo. 24.06.19Mustermann1
31Di. 25.06.19Mustermann1
32Mi. 26.06.19Mustermann1
33Do. 27.06.19Mustermann1
34Fr. 28.06.19Mustermann1
35Sa. 29.06.19
36So. 30.06.19
37

Zellebedingte Formatierung...Format
A101: VERGLEICH(A10;$D$7:$D23;0)>0abc
A102: WOCHENTAG(A10;2)>5abc
B101: ZÄHLENWENN($D$7:$D$20;$A10)+WENNFEHLER(WOCHENTAG($A10;2)>5;0)+($A10="")abc

Gruß Ralf
Gib einem Mann einen Fisch und du ernährst ihn für einen Tag. 
Lehre einen Mann zu fischen und du ernährst ihn für sein Leben. (Konfuzius)
[-] Folgende(r) 1 Nutzer sagt Danke an RPP63 für diesen Beitrag:
  • schluckspecht
Antworten Top
#6
Hallo,

bei diesen vielen Vorschlägen bleibt nur noch wenig Platz für weitere Kommentare:

M.W.n bietet nur die Funktion "=Arbeitstag()" die Möglichkeit eine Liste der (regionalen) Feiertage zu übergeben, sonauso wie eine explizite Definition, welche Tage "Arbeitstage" sind. Also für die Frage müßten dann Sa + So ausgewählt werden.

mfg
Antworten Top
#7
Hallöchen,

wenn Du, wie anfangs geschrieben, die Namen wirklich manuell eingibst so kannst Du dann doch die Gültigkeit auf die Inhalte der Nachbarzelle ausrichten. Ich hab hier mal was prinzipielles. Damit bekomme ich die Jacke, Du die Hose und Er bleibt ohne … Genau so gut kannst Du per ZÄHLENWENN prüfen, ob das Datum in der Nachbarzelle in der Liste Deiner Feiertage steht und wenn ja, gibt's keine EIngabe ...

Arbeitsblatt mit dem Namen 'Tabelle1'
AB
1WerWas
2ichJacke
3duHose
4er
5ichJacke

ZelleGültigkeitstypOperatorWert1Wert2
B2Benutzerdefiniert=ODER(UND($A2="ich";$B2="Jacke");UND($A2="du";$B2="Hose"))
B3Benutzerdefiniert=ODER(UND($A3="ich";$B3="Jacke");UND($A3="du";$B3="Hose"))
B4Benutzerdefiniert=ODER(UND($A4="ich";$B4="Jacke");UND($A4="du";$B4="Hose"))
B5Benutzerdefiniert=ODER(UND($A5="ich";$B5="Jacke");UND($A5="du";$B5="Hose"))
Verwendete Systemkomponenten: [Windows (32-bit) NT 10.00] MS Excel 2016
Diese Tabelle wurde mit Tab2Html (v2.6.2) erstellt. ©Gerd alias Bamberg


Arbeitsblatt mit dem Namen 'Tabelle1'
DEFG
101. Jan01. Jan
206. Jan02. Jan

ZelleGültigkeitstypOperatorWert1Wert2
G1Benutzerdefiniert=ZÄHLENWENN($D$1:$D$2;F1)=0
G2Benutzerdefiniert=ZÄHLENWENN($D$1:$D$2;F2)=0
Verwendete Systemkomponenten: [Windows (32-bit) NT 10.00] MS Excel 2016
Diese Tabelle wurde mit Tab2Html (v2.6.2) erstellt. ©Gerd alias Bamberg
.      \\\|///      Hoffe, geholfen zu haben.
       ( ô ô )      Grüße, André aus G in T  
  ooO-(_)-Ooo    (Excel 97-2019+365)
Antworten Top
#8
(27.08.2019, 06:28)RPP63 schrieb: Moin!
Du färbst in Spalte A doch bereits die WE und Feiertage korrekt per Formel ein!
Setze für Spalte B eine weitere bedingte Formatierung, wenn es Dir "nur" um die Darstellung geht.
Formel ist: =ZÄHLENWENN($D$7:$D$20;$A7)+WENNFEHLER(WOCHENTAG($A7;2)>5;0)+($A7="")
ben.def. Zahlenformat ist ;;;

.....
Gruß Ralf

Passt *Daumenhoch*

@schauan
ja,war mein Fehler,das Wort "manuell" zu definieren.
Auch dir ein Dank für die Mühe.
Antworten Top


Gehe zu:


Benutzer, die gerade dieses Thema anschauen: 1 Gast/Gäste